Levistor, the British company that is developing a low cost, durable energy storage technology that will enable super-fast charging of electric vehicles, has secured a £545,000 grant from the UK Office for Zero Emission Vehicles, in partnership with Innovate UK. Industry says state is ‘up there with best global practice’ as environment minister aims for 52% of new car sales by 2030-31 The New South Wales government will waive stamp duty on electric vehicle purchases and provide subsidies for 25,000 new purchases as part of a $490m strategy to drive uptake of EVs. The Department of Heavy Industries on Friday evening doubled the maximum subsidy extended to electric two-wheelers buyers under the FAME scheme, which manufacturers say will speed up the adoption of these vehicles in India.
